Late posting, my stay was during December 2018.||I’ve always wanted to stay in this hotel, and have heard so much about them. I booked my stay thru Ctrip. ||I arrived in the afternoon, and the taxi will pull up in front of the hotel (one way road). Do ask the door staff to help if you have a lot of baggage, but I did not. The lobby is a few steps from the ground level, such a classic feeling and fun. Look out for touts in front of the hotel at night, they usually ask if you’d need massage service, so please don’t fall for it.||The reception was nice and upgraded my room to a corner room which is slight larger, but a fantastic view overlooking the Renmin Square gardens. The room was so spacious, well lit, everything working well, super clean and well maintained. The bathroom offers all the amenities that you would need and complimentary water is provided daily.||The bath offers a standing shower option, and I’m amazed that it even comes with the Japanese style bidet for the WC.||Overall, a wonderful stay and I would love to come...

The park is a lovely historic hotel - fabulous to be able to stay in a piece of Shanghai's history! The rooms are spacious but showing their age a bit with wallpaper peeling in spots and some creaky floorboards. The view over the park was beautiful and the location is hard to beat! Breakfast had a great range of Chinese food, with a few standard western options, it could get crowded and I had to share a table one morning. The cafe/bar in the lobby was pleasant with afternoon tea and a limited drinks menu and live music (pleasant lounge jazz), the deli is famous for its palmiers and people queue around the block to get them! The doorman was always very friendly, the staff at the desk were pleasant if not a little nonplussed. The hotel also had a great little museum on the second floor with their history. If you want to stay in an iconic Shanghai landmark and love history and don't mind dates rooms then the Park is a fabulous option. The nearby historical museum is great and the People's Park is lovely to wander through.

This hotel is conveniently located near a metro station and within walking distance of the famous Nanjing Road and People’s Park. It is one of the older hotels in the city and has a classic, vintage charm. However, the rooms do show their age. The hotel was quite crowded during our stay, especially at the breakfast counter, which remained busy throughout the morning. Breakfast options for vegans were quite limited—but given that it’s China, that’s somewhat expected, so we can't really complain. Overall, our stay was pleasant. The Bund is also nearby and easily walkable. Alternatively, you can take a taxi. The hop-on hop-off bus stop is close as well. There are plenty of eateries within walking distance, including popular global chains like McDonald’s, KFC, and Burger King.
